- Firstly, Cross-Functional product team is defined as ‘’ A team consisting of representatives from the
various functions involved in product development, usually including members from all key functions
required to deliver a successful product…The team is empowered by the departments to represent
each function’s perspective in the development process “by the PDMA Handbook of New Product
Development. The purpose of a cross-functional product team is to manage all the elements needed
to achieve the financial, market, and strategic objectives of product, as a business, all levels of an
organization; also, from outside of a company such as suppliers, key customers, consultants. The
cross-functional product team is made up of delegated representatives from their respective
business functions. This team is responsible for making sure that plans are executed in a timely
fashion.

- Thirdly, Feasibility is the possibility that can be made, done, or achieved, or is reasonable,
capable of being used or dealt with successfully. A feasibility study is an assessment of the
practicality of a proposed plan or project and designed to identify potential issues and problems
that could arise from pursuing the project. It analyzes the viability of a project to determine
whether the project or venture is likely to succeed. designed to identify potential issues and
problems that could arise from pursuing the project.
